COUPLES planning their wedding can have a look around Durham's register office at an open day on Sunday.
Durham County Council is opening its registration service venue at Aykley Heads between 11am and 3pm on Sunday, April 2, to allow couples to look around. There will also be a selection of local suppliers of cakes, cars, flowers and wedding dresses.
Wendy Addison-Smyth, the council's ceremony coordination team leader, said: “The open day is a perfect opportunity for couples to visit us, have a look around and book their wedding, as well as offering the chance to meet suppliers and plan aspects of their big day.”
